Why choose the eLearning Option?

PADI eLearning can a great option for students that wish to complete the required theory work in the comfort of your own home and in your own time.  You'll still need to do a class session to do the course induction, fill in paperwork, and sit your final exam.  For this reason, we still recommend that you come along the first class session on the Open Water schedule.  This way you can also meet your fellow students on the course and we can answer any questions you may have.  The PADI eLearning option is £70 more expensive than the standard course at £565 and includes everything you require for the course including the online materials, kit hire, tuition and final certification.

To enrol in a PADI Open Water Diver course (or Junior Open Water Diver course) with SCUBA DIVING SCOTLAND, you must be at least 12 years old or older. You need adequate swimming skills and need to be in good physical health. No prior experience with scuba diving is required.  If you are under 16 years old we may be restricted on what courses we can teach due to the child's capabilities or due to the size and fitting of the Drysuits for Open Water dives.

What will you learn?

The PADI Open Water Diver course consists of three main phases:

  • Knowledge Development ( online, independent study or in a classroom) to understand basic principles of scuba diving
  • Confined Water Dives to learn basic scuba skills
  • Open Water Dives to use your skills and explore!

What scuba gear will you use?

In the PADI Open Water Diver course, you learn to use basic scuba gear, including a mask, snorkel, fins, regulator, buoyancy control device and a tank. The equipment you wear varies, depending upon whether you’re diving in tropical, temperate or cold water.  However, in Scotland we generally wear a Drysuit with undersuit for the Open Water dives.
